Spiritual Formation

“We often say, “I am not very happy. I am not content with the way my life is going. I am not really joyful or peaceful. But I don’t know how things can be different, and I guess I have to be realistic and accept my life as it is.” It is this mood of resignation that prevents us from actively naming our reality, articulating our experience, and moving more deeply into the life of the Spirit.
― Henri J.M. Nouwen, Spiritual Formation: Following the Movements of the Spirit

GROUPS AT THE WELL EXIST TO DEVELOP COMMUNITY WITH GOD AND ONE ANOTHER.

Groups are home base for transformation and spiritual formation in our church. They meet on various days of the week in the homes of our members and are coached by our Deacon team. Expect Acts 2 realities in a group: prayer, scripture, fellowship, sharing of meals and what we have in common because of Jesus Christ. The Bible passage preached each Sunday is our curriculum and the one another commands of the New Testament are what we practice and pray.

Elder led prayer is a monthly time that we set aside to pray, praise, and practice the presence of God. We are learning to do all of life and ministry through prayer. When we come together as a body at 5pm on the first Sunday of each month we seek to do that very thing. We pray together. We bear each other’s burdens, we pray for our church, we pray for our city and we pray for our world.  These meetings are a rich time of fellowship with God and one another.  Come and rediscover with us the gift and the joy of a praying community.
